Gokyo Lakes - A Must-Visit on the Everest Base Camp Trek
The Everest Base Camp Trek is regarded as one of the most astounding treks in the Himalayan region of Nepal for all its beauty, magnificence and adventure. Add the unexplored marvels of the Gokyo Lakes region to it and what you get is an unbeatable adventure-the Everest Base Camp Trek with Gokyo Lakes!
The trek starts with the classic Everest Base Camp trek but takes a deviation to Gokyo RI and then to the Cho La Pass that is a high pass and finally joins back at the main Everest Base Camp Trek route.
Gokyo RI has a series of six high altitudes, beautiful turquoise blue lakes, a high pass and a beautiful trail that is less crowded than the usual trail. The trail promises the best of the entire Everest region. Gokyo RI is actually a summit at the Gokyo village that overlooks the two lakes and promises some of the best views. You can actually view two beautiful lakes, a glacier and also the Makalu, Everest, Lhotse and Cho Oyu, four of the highest summits in the region.

Gokyo Lake Trek is about three days longer than the usual Everest Base Camp Trek and it is also a little more difficult than the EBC Trek as it involves trekking the Gokyo RI that is 17,575 ft; Chola Pass which is 17,500 ft and the Kala Patthar at 18,190 ft. So it would not be wrong to call this one an intense trek and one must come all prepared in terms of fitness for this trek.
What to expect while at the trek?
The 17-day long trek explores the little known Gokyo Village that is located in the valley of Khumbu region. You will also get a chance to visit the traditional villages besides passing by the most tranquil Gokyo lakes in the region-Gokyo Ri and the Fifth Lake. Trek the popular trail of Cho La Pass and then hike the popular black rock called the Kala Patthar. Also on the trek, enjoy some of the most spectacular views of the high peaks such as Everest, Nuptse, Lhotse, Pumari, and others. And last but certainly not the least, spend a day full of excitement and thrill at the Everest Base Camp and enjoy your victory.
For all those of you who have been wondering if you miss the attractions at the main Everest Base Camp Trek by taking the alternate route, the answer is a big NO! The Gokyo lake Trek joins back at the Cho La Pass which is before the base camp for Kala Patthar and the Everest Base Camp. So practically there is nothing that you are going to miss - from the Everest Base Camp to Khumbu Glacier, Climber’s stand, Kala Patthar, and then the trek down route is certainly from the classic EBC Trek itself.
Fitness levels for the Trek
The EBC Trek or the Gokyo Ri Trek is graded as a difficult trek which makes it necessary for the trekkers to qualify for a particular level of fitness. It requires both flexibility and strength. The trek requires about 7 to 8 hours of trekking a day, sleeping at altitudes that are about 15,000 ft or above. The trekkers need to trek altitude of 17,000 feet for about four times in this trek-the Gokyo RI Summit at 17, 575 ft; Chola Pass at 17,782 ft; the Everest Base Camp at 17,600 ft and the Kala Patthar at 18,513 ft. The high altitudes and long hours of trekking together make this trek a grueling task in itself.
